Functional Descriptions
(Continued)
Assuming, the following conditions:
V
out
= 2.5V
V
in
= 3.3V
V
ctrl
= 5V
I
out
= 2A DC Avg.
Calculate the maximum power dissipation using the following equation:
P
d
= I
out
* ( V
in
- V
out
) + ( I
out
/60) * ( V
ctrl
- V
out
)
P
d
= 2 * (3.3-2.5) + (2/60) * (5-2.5) = 1.68W
Using table below select the proper package and the amount of copper board needed.
